Abstract
The Internet of Things (IoT) has revolutionized device interconnectivity in both industrial and home environments. How- ever, the lack of interoperability between proprietary solutions has hindered its widespread adoption. To address this, open standards such as MQTT and later Matter have emerged as leading protocols for smart home applications. This paper presents a comparative analysis of MQTT and Matter, focusing on their architectures and performance in terms of communication latency through an experimental setup designed to measure the response time of both protocols in a real-world domestic scenario.
